Eights Motorbikes donated to National Teachers Association county chapters

The National Teachers Association of Liberia(NTAL) has presented eight new motorbikes for use by its  county presidents.

The counties include Montserrado, Bong,Nimba, Margibi, Gbarpolu, Bomi, Grand Bassa and Grand Cape Mount Counties.

NTAL president madam Mary W. Mulbah-Nyumah noted that the mobility will ensure effective and efficient reporting of issues around  teachers in the various counties.

She maintained that the association is doing everything possible to advocate for the improvement of Liberian teachers living standard in the teaching profession.

According to her, the perception that teachers are poor set of people,  is untrue noting that the teaching is a noble profession that can also help to transform the society.

Madam Nyumah stressed that the motorbikes  will go a long way to ease   county presidents  movement gather relevant information concerning teachers in the various educational districts to inform the head office.

She emphasized that with the partnership between the association and SAAR Insurance Company, the motorbikes were made available to improve the condition of the county presidents.

Meanwhile, the Secretary General of NATL, Dominic D. M. Suah Sr. said the motorbikes for officials in the counties will ensure the present of the association in every educational districts across the country.

Mr. Suah stated that the brain of the association more are depend on the county presidents to have easy access to the difficult roads in the counties and districts.

He said they are grateful to the dynamic leadership especially the Natuonal President Nyumah for her farsighted to ensure that the county presidents  get motorbikes for their smooth operation.

In a related development, the county presidents expressed thank and appreciation to the National Leadership of NATL for making avaliable these motorbikes to them.

They noted that the bad roads condition in the various is hampering the effectiveness and efficiency of their works, but with mobility such as motorbikes they will be able to reach places which  are most difficult to access by vehicles.
